It's made with two packages of crescent rolls. You cook your taco meat (about 1 lb) with seasonings, then place in the dough and wrap the tips around it. You need to layer the rolls into a circle or you can just do a long braid. After it's cooked, you can serve w/ taco toppings so that everyone just makes their favorite; tomatoes, lettuce, olives, cheddar cheese, salsa, sour cream, guacamole, etc. Hope this helps!

Apple Berry Salsa with Cinnamon Chips





Cinnamon Chips





4 flour tortillas


1 Tbs. sugar


1/2 tsp. cinnamon





Salsa





2 medium Granny smith apples


1 cup strawberries, sliced


1 kiwi, peeled and chopped


1 small orange


2 Tbsp. packed brown sugar


2 Tbsp. apple jelly





Preheat oven 400. For chips, lightly spray tortillas with water using kitchen spritzer. Combine cinnamon and sugar and sprinkle over tortillas, cut into 8 wedges and bake 8 to 10 min. Cool completely.


For salsa, peel, core and slice apples and chop into pieces. Slice strawberries and chop kiwi. Place fruit in a bowl. Zest orange and juice orange and add to fruit. Add brown sugar and jelly. mix gently. Serve with cinnamon chips.
I have a recipe for Mango Salsa from Pampered Chef.





1 Cup strawberries, hulled and finely diced


1 ripe mango, peeled and finely diced


1 Kiwi, peeled and finely diced


1 lime





Zest 1 tsp of lime. Sqeeze 1 TB of lime juice. Combine lime zest, juice, strawberries, mangos, and kiwi; stir gently. They put it over ice cream. I hope this helps.

    Chicken %26amp; Broccoli Filling





    2 cups coarsely chopped cooked chicken


    1 1/2 cups coarsely chopped broccoli


    1 cup (4 ounces) shredded cheddar cheese


    1/2 cup diced red bell pepper


    1/3 cup mayo


    2 teaspoons Pantry All-Purpose Dill Mix or dried dill weed


    1/4 teaspoon salt


    1 garlic clove, pressed


    1 egg white, lightly beaten


    1/4 cup slivered almonds








    1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. In Classic Batter Bowl, combine chicken, broccoli, cheese, bell pepper, mayo, seasoning mix, salt and garlic; mix well.





    2. Scoop filling over desired shape (in your case, the ';wreath';); finish shape as directed. Brush with egg white. Sprinkle with almonds. Bake 25-30 minutes or until golden brown.

    The Crab Rangoon Dip came out of the Season's Best Fall/Winter 2007 cookbook and here it is:


    1 8oz pk cream cheese, softened


    1 garlic clove, pressed


    1 cup shredded swiss cheese


    3/4 cup sweet n sour sauce


    1/2 pk(8oz) imitation crabmeat


    1 green onion with top


    1/4 cup toasted sliced almonds


    In small bowl, combine cream cheese and garlic. Add swiss cheese. Mix until well blended. Pour into mini-baker. Spoon sweet n sour sauce over cream cheese mixture. Coarsely chop crabmeat and sprinkle over sauce. Microwave on high 4-6 minutes or until bubbly. Meanwhile thinly slice green onion. Sprinkle over top of dip. Sprinkle almonds over top of that. Serve warm with crispy wonton chips.Pampered chef recipes

    Crab Rangoon Dip:





    Ingredients:





    1 package (8oz) cream cheese, softened


    1 garlic clove, pressed.


    4 oz shredded Swiss Cheese. (I actually used the already grated Italian cheese blend)


    3/4 cup sweet and sour sauce


    1 cup chopped imitation crabmeat


    1/4 cup sliced almonds (I forgot these the other night)





    Directions:





    Mix the cream cheese and garlic and spread into the bottom of an 8 inch round pan (mini baker if you are using PC stoneware)


    Spread the swiss cheese over the top of the cream cheese mixture and then top with the sweet and sour sauce, the crabmeat and almonds.


    Bake in a 350 degree oven for 22-25 minutes.


    Serve warm with Wonton Chips.





    Buffalo Chicken Dip





    Ingredients Needed:





    * 2-4 Boneless Chicken Breasts, cooked and coarsely chopped or shredded


    * 2 (8 oz.) Cream Cheese


    * 1 cup Blue Cheese Salad Dressing( chunky)


    * 1 cup Hot Sauce ( Frank's hot wing sauce)


    * 3/4 cup chopped celery


    * 6 oz. shredded Cheddar Cheese





    Instructions:





    Cook chicken breast in Micro Cooker and chop coarsely with Food Chopper.





    Saut茅 celery in Hot Sauce in Small Saut茅 Pan.





    Soften cream cheese in Classic Batter Bowl in microwave the combine with Hot Sauce/celery. Measure Blue Cheese Salad Dressing in measure all cup and add to Chicken. Add half of the Cheddar Cheese.





    Pour into a Stoneware piece. The Oval Baker, Deep Dish, or Square Baker work very well.





    Sprinkle remaining cheese on top and bake at 400 degrees for 25-30 minutes until hot and bubbly.


    Serve with Tortilla Chips and/or celery sticks

    Crab Rangoon Dip





    SERVES 16 (change servings and units)


    Ingredients





    * 8 ounces cream cheese, softened


    * 1 garlic clove, pressed


    * 1 cup swiss cheese, shredded


    * 3/4 cup sweet and sour sauce


    * 4 ounces imitation crabmeat


    * 1/4 cup green onion, thinly sliced


    * 32 wonton wrappers


    * vegetable oil





    Directions





    1


    In small bowl, combine cream cheese and garlic. Add swiss cheese; stir until well blended. Spread cream cheese mixture over bottom of 1 quart baking dish. Spoon sweet and sour sauce over cream cheese mixture.


    2


    Coarsely chop crab meat; sprinkle over sauce. Microwave uncovered 4-6 minutes on High or until outside edges are bubbly and dip is heated through. Remove and sprinkle with thinly sliced green onions. Serve warm with crispy wonton chips.


    3


    Crispy Wonton Chips:.


    4


    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Cut wonton wrappers in half diagonally. Arrange half of wontons in single layer on large pizza pan or stone. Spray with oil using kitchen spritzer. Bake 8-10 minutes or until golden brown and crisp. Remove chips from pan. Cool completely.








    Buffalo Chicken Dip





    INGREDIENTS





    * 2 (10 ounce) cans chunk chicken, drained


    * 2 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ese, softened


    * 1 cup Ranch dressing


    * 3/4 cup pepper sauce, such as Franks庐 Red Hot庐


    * 1 1/2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ese


    * 1 bunch celery, cleaned and cut into 4 inch pieces


    * 1 (8 ounce) box chicken-flavored crackers








    DIRECTIONS





    1. Heat chicken and hot sauce in a skillet over medium heat, until heated through. Stir in cream cheese and ranch dressing. Cook, stirring until well blended and warm. Mix in half of the shredded cheese, and transfer the mixture to a slow cooker. Sprinkle the remaining cheese over the top, cover, and cook on Low setting until hot and bubbly. Serve with celery sticks and crackers.





    Serves 20.

    Pina Colada Refresher





    2 cups pineapple juice


    2 cartons (6 ounces each) pina colada yogurt


    1/2 cup cream of coconut**





    Place all ingredints in Quickstir Pitcher. Mix well with plunger. Refrigerate until ready to serve. Serve over ice and garnish with a pineapple slice or a maraschino cherry.





    Yield: 8 (1 cup) servings.





    **Cream of coconut is a nonalcoholic product that is sold in 15-16 ounce cans and can be found in most grocery stores near other cocktail ingredients such as maraschino cherries, cocktail onions, or bloody mary mix. Most liquor stores will carry this product.





    Approximately 139 calories and 5 grams of fat per serving.

    Pina Colada Smoothie





    Delicious, healthy and refreshing! From the California Milk Advisory Board.


    by BecR





    1/2 cup crushed pineapple


    1/2 teaspoon coconut extract


    1 cup milk


    1 (8 ounce) carton plain yogurt





    Blend ingredients until frothy and serve icy cold.


    Makes about 3 cups.
